They are the limited edition take on the new evoSPEED 1.2 CAMO which will be unveiled later this month. Manchester United and Chelsea target Rademel Falcao, who puts them to the test in the video below, will also parade them when Atletico Madrid take on Deportivo La Coruna this Saturday and Barcelona, eight days later. [video=youtube;wTdmYsQvsSw]http://www.youtube.com/watch?feature=player_embedded&v=wTdmYsQvsSw[/video] 'Blink and they'll be gone' is the slogan from the bootmaker, who have incorporated a new 'speedtrack outsole' which they say 'improves turning and reactivity' in addition to a new monololayer microfiber that covers the boots to enhance a players touch and feel of the ball.
